- package lvmutils
- import (
- "encoding/json"
- "fmt"
- "strconv"
- "strings"
- "yunion.io/x/log"
- "yunion.io/x/pkg/errors"
- "yunion.io/x/onecloud/pkg/util/procutils"
- )
- type LvNames struct {
- Report []struct {
- LV []struct {
- LVName string `json:"lv_name"`
- } `json:"lv"`
- } `json:"report"`
- }
- func GetLvNames(vg string) ([]string, error) {
- cmd := fmt.Sprintf("lvm lvs --reportformat json -o lv_name %s 2>/dev/null", vg)
- lvs, err := procutils.NewRemoteCommandAsFarAsPossible("bash", "-c", cmd).Output()
- if err != nil {
- return nil, errors.Wrap(err, "lvm lvs")
- }
- var res LvNames
- err = json.Unmarshal(lvs, &res)
- if err != nil {
- return nil, errors.Wrap(err, "unmarshal lvs")
- }
- if len(res.Report) != 1 {
- return nil, errors.Errorf("unexpect res %v", res)
- }
- lvNames := make([]string, 0, len(res.Report[0].LV))
- for i := 0; i < len(res.Report[0].LV); i++ {
- lvNames = append(lvNames, res.Report[0].LV[i].LVName)
- }
- return lvNames, nil
- }
- type LvOrigin struct {
- Report []struct {
- LV []struct {
- Origin string `json:"origin"`
- } `json:"lv"`
- } `json:"report"`
- }
- func GetLvOrigin(lvPath string) (string, error) {
- cmd := fmt.Sprintf("lvm lvs --reportformat json -o origin %s 2>/dev/null", lvPath)
- lvs, err := procutils.NewRemoteCommandAsFarAsPossible("bash", "-c", cmd).Output()
- if err != nil {
- return "", errors.Wrap(err, "lvm lvs")
- }
- var res LvOrigin
- err = json.Unmarshal(lvs, &res)
- if err != nil {
- return "", errors.Wrap(err, "unmarshal lvs")
- }
- if len(res.Report) == 1 && len(res.Report[0].LV) == 1 {
- return res.Report[0].LV[0].Origin, nil
- }
- return "", errors.Errorf("unexpect res %v", res)
- }
- type LvActive struct {
- Report []struct {
- LV []struct {
- LvActive string `json:"lv_active"`
- } `json:"lv"`
- } `json:"report"`
- }
- func LvIsActivated(lvPath string) (bool, error) {
- cmd := fmt.Sprintf("lvm lvs --reportformat json -o lv_active %s 2>/dev/null", lvPath)
- lvs, err := procutils.NewRemoteCommandAsFarAsPossible("bash", "-c", cmd).Output()
- if err != nil {
- return false, errors.Wrap(err, "lvm lvs")
- }
- var res LvActive
- err = json.Unmarshal(lvs, &res)
- if err != nil {
- return false, errors.Wrap(err, "unmarshal lvs")
- }
- if len(res.Report) == 1 && len(res.Report[0].LV) == 1 {
- return res.Report[0].LV[0].LvActive == "active", nil
- }
- return false, errors.Errorf("unexpect res %v", res)
- }
- func LVActive(lvPath string, share, exclusive bool) error {
- opts := "-ay"
- if share {
- opts += "s"
- } else if exclusive {
- opts += "e"
- }
- cmd := fmt.Sprintf("lvm lvchange %s %s", opts, lvPath)
- out, err := procutils.NewRemoteCommandAsFarAsPossible("bash", "-c", cmd).Output()
- if err != nil {
- return errors.Wrapf(err, "lvchange %s %s failed %s", opts, lvPath, out)
- }
- return nil
- }
- func LVDeactivate(lvPath string) error {
- opts := "-an"
- cmd := fmt.Sprintf("lvm lvchange %s %s", opts, lvPath)
- out, err := procutils.NewRemoteCommandAsFarAsPossible("bash", "-c", cmd).Output()
- if err != nil {
- return errors.Wrapf(err, "lvchange %s %s failed %s", opts, lvPath, out)
- }
- return nil
- }
- func LvScan() error {
- cmd := "lvm lvscan"
- out, err := procutils.NewRemoteCommandAsFarAsPossible("bash", "-c", cmd).Output()
- if err != nil {
- return errors.Wrapf(err, "lvscan failed %s", out)
- }
- return nil
- }
- type VgProps struct {
- VgSize int64
- VgFree int64
- VgExtentSize int64
- }
- type VgReports struct {
- Report []struct {
- VG []struct {
- VgSize string `json:"vg_size"`
- VgFree string `json:"vg_free"`
- VgExtentSize string `json:"vg_extent_size"`
- } `json:"vg"`
- } `json:"report"`
- }
- // lvm units https://access.redhat.com/documentation/en-us/red_hat_enterprise_linux/6/html/logical_volume_manager_administration/report_units
- func GetVgProps(vg string) (*VgProps, error) {
- cmd := fmt.Sprintf("lvm vgs --reportformat json -o vg_free,vg_size,vg_extent_size --units=B %s 2>/dev/null", vg)
- out, err := procutils.NewRemoteCommandAsFarAsPossible("bash", "-c", cmd).Output()
- if err != nil {
- return nil, errors.Wrapf(err, "exec lvm command %s: %s", cmd, out)
- }
- var vgReports VgReports
- err = json.Unmarshal(out, &vgReports)
- if err != nil {
- return nil, errors.Wrapf(err, "unmarshal vgprops %s", out)
- }
- if len(vgReports.Report) == 1 && len(vgReports.Report[0].VG) == 1 {
- var vgProps VgProps
- vgProps.VgExtentSize, err = strconv.ParseInt(strings.TrimSuffix(vgReports.Report[0].VG[0].VgExtentSize, "B"), 10, 64)
- if err != nil {
- return nil, errors.Wrapf(err, "parse extent size %s", vgReports.Report[0].VG[0].VgExtentSize)
- }
- vgProps.VgFree, err = strconv.ParseInt(strings.TrimSuffix(vgReports.Report[0].VG[0].VgFree, "B"), 10, 64)
- if err != nil {
- return nil, errors.Wrapf(err, "parse free size %s", vgReports.Report[0].VG[0].VgFree)
- }
- vgProps.VgSize, err = strconv.ParseInt(strings.TrimSuffix(vgReports.Report[0].VG[0].VgSize, "B"), 10, 64)
- if err != nil {
- return nil, errors.Wrapf(err, "parse size %s", vgReports.Report[0].VG[0].VgSize)
- }
- return &vgProps, nil
- } else {
- return nil, errors.Errorf("invalid vg report %v", vgReports)
- }
- }
- func ExtendLvSize(vg string, size int64) (int64, error) {
- vgProps, err := GetVgProps(vg)
- if err != nil {
- return -1, err
- }
- extentSize := vgProps.VgExtentSize
- return (size + extentSize - 1) / extentSize * extentSize, nil
- }
- func LvCreate(vg, lv string, size int64) error {
- size, err := ExtendLvSize(vg, size)
- if err != nil {
- return err
- }
- out, err := procutils.NewRemoteCommandAsFarAsPossible(
- "lvm", "lvcreate", "--size", fmt.Sprintf("%dB", size), "-n", lv, vg, "-y",
- ).Output()
- if err != nil {
- return errors.Wrapf(err, "LvCreate failed %s", out)
- }
- return nil
- }
- func LvCreateFromSnapshot(lv, snapShotPath string, size int64) error {
- out, err := procutils.NewRemoteCommandAsFarAsPossible(
- "lvm", "lvcreate", "--size", fmt.Sprintf("%dB", size), "-n", lv, "-s", snapShotPath, "-y",
- ).Output()
- if err != nil {
- return errors.Wrapf(err, "LvCreate from snapshot %s failed %s", snapShotPath, out)
- }
- return nil
- }
- // @param: lvPath string: should like /dev/<vg>/<lv>
- func LvResize(vg, lvPath string, size int64) error {
- size, err := ExtendLvSize(vg, size)
- if err != nil {
- return err
- }
- out, err := procutils.NewRemoteCommandAsFarAsPossible(
- "lvm", "lvresize", "--size", fmt.Sprintf("%dB", size), lvPath, "-y",
- ).Output()
- if err != nil {
- return errors.Wrapf(err, "LvResize failed %s", out)
- }
- return nil
- }
- // @param: lvPath string: should like /dev/<vg>/<lv>
- func LvRemove(lvPath string) error {
- if out, err := procutils.NewCommand("dd", "if=/dev/zero", fmt.Sprintf("of=%s", lvPath), "bs=10M", "count=16").Output(); err != nil {
- log.Errorf("failed dd zero to lv %s: %s %s", lvPath, out, err)
- }
- out, err := procutils.NewRemoteCommandAsFarAsPossible("lvm", "lvremove", lvPath, "-y").Output()
- if err != nil {
- return errors.Wrapf(err, "LvRemove failed %s", out)
- }
- return nil
- }
- // @param: dmPath string: should like /dev/mapper/<device>
- func DmRemove(dmPath string) error {
- out, err := procutils.NewRemoteCommandAsFarAsPossible("dmsetup", "remove", dmPath).Output()
- if err != nil {
- return errors.Wrapf(err, "DmRemove failed %s", out)
- }
- return nil
- }
- func DmCreate(lv1, lv2, dmName string) error {
- var dmCreateScript = `
- size1=$(blockdev --getsz $1)
- size2=$(blockdev --getsz $2)
- echo "0 $size1 linear $1 0
- $size1 $size2 linear $2 0" | dmsetup create $3
- `
- out, err := procutils.NewRemoteCommandAsFarAsPossible("bash", "-c", dmCreateScript, "--", lv1, lv2, dmName).Output()
- if err != nil {
- return errors.Wrapf(err, "create device mapper failed %s", out)
- }
- return nil
- }
- func VgDisplay(vgName string) error {
- out, err := procutils.NewRemoteCommandAsFarAsPossible("lvm", "vgdisplay", vgName).Output()
- if err != nil {
- return errors.Wrapf(err, "vgdisplay %s failed %s", vgName, out)
- }
- return nil
- }
- func VgActive(vgName string, active, autoActivation bool) error {
- opts := "-ay"
- if !active {
- opts = "-an"
- }
- if active && autoActivation {
- opts = "-aay"
- }
- out, err := procutils.NewRemoteCommandAsFarAsPossible("lvm", "vgchange", opts, vgName).Output()
- if err != nil {
- return errors.Wrapf(err, "vgchange %s %s failed %s", opts, vgName, out)
- }
- return nil
- }
- func LvRename(vgName, oldName, newName string) error {
- out, err := procutils.NewRemoteCommandAsFarAsPossible("lvm", "lvrename", vgName, oldName, newName).Output()
- if err != nil {
- return errors.Wrapf(err, "lvrename vg: %s oldName: %s newName: %s failed: %s", vgName, oldName, newName, out)
- }
- return nil
- }
- func GetQcow2LvSize(sizeMb int64) int64 {
- // 100G reserve 1M for qcow2 metadata
- metaSize := sizeMb/1024/100 + 10
- return sizeMb + metaSize
- }
- // get lvsize unit byte
- func GetLvSize(lvPath string) (int64, error) {
- cmd := fmt.Sprintf("lvm lvs %s -o LV_SIZE --noheadings --units B --nosuffix 2>/dev/null", lvPath)
- out, err := procutils.NewRemoteCommandAsFarAsPossible("bash", "-c", cmd).Output()
- if err != nil {
- return -1, errors.Wrapf(err, "exec lvm command %s: %s", cmd, out)
- }
- strSize := strings.TrimSpace(string(out))
- size, err := strconv.ParseInt(strSize, 10, 64)
- if err != nil {
- return -1, errors.Wrapf(err, "failed parse size %s", strSize)
- }
- return size, nil
- }
